From ecc698a4161c9adae91e61baffea8e82c7030780 Mon Sep 17 00:00:00 2001 From: hjk Date: Mon, 19 Aug 2019 11:32:43 +0200 Subject: [PATCH] Debugger: Remove unused QmlEngine::sourceEditors It look like it has been always empty for a while. Change-Id: I4d169294a93f22ffa6a49203e2cd34a9e0bf924c Reviewed-by: Ulf Hermann --- src/plugins/debugger/qml/qmlengine.cpp | 11 ----------- 1 file changed, 11 deletions(-) diff --git a/src/plugins/debugger/qml/qmlengine.cpp b/src/plugins/debugger/qml/qmlengine.cpp index db1e9aee9ad..40a16d93d88 100644 --- a/src/plugins/debugger/qml/qmlengine.cpp +++ b/src/plugins/debugger/qml/qmlengine.cpp @@ -218,7 +218,6 @@ public: QList sendBuffer; QHash sourceDocuments; - QHash > sourceEditors; InteractiveInterpreter interpreter; ApplicationLauncher applicationLauncher; QmlInspectorAgent inspectorAgent; @@ -312,16 +311,6 @@ QmlEngine::QmlEngine() QmlEngine::~QmlEngine() { QObject::disconnect(d->startupMessageFilterConnection); - QSet documentsToClose; - - QHash >::iterator iter; - for (iter = d->sourceEditors.begin(); iter != d->sourceEditors.end(); ++iter) { - QWeakPointer textEditPtr = iter.value(); - if (textEditPtr) - documentsToClose << textEditPtr.toStrongRef().data()->document(); - } - EditorManager::closeDocuments(Utils::toList(documentsToClose)); - delete d; }